I need to create a composite surface that represents the LOWEST of a bunch of surfaces which are stacked on top of each other at different elevations. Kind of like a 3D boolean addition but I only want single surface representing the lowest plane, or an upside down drape mesh. When it's generated properly looking at it from above it should appear as a concave hull. A bit hard to explain but if I were writing an algorithm to do it, this is what it would look like..
Declare a bounding area "area1"
For each "x","y" point within area1
for each surface stacked at this point
if "z" is LOWEST
set area1 (x,y,z)
endif
endfor
Can anyone point me in the right direction on how to achieve this?
